Chasing money is the message everyone puts off. You do not want to sound rude to a customer you might keep, but you also need to be paid. So the reminder sits unwritten, and the debt gets older.

This is a perfect stage 1 job - using AI as a fast assistant. One prompt, and the letter you have been avoiding is done.

The prompt#

Write a firm but professional payment-reminder letter to a customer.
 
Details:
- Customer: [name]
- Invoice: [number], for KES [amount]
- It was due on [date] and is now [number] days overdue
- This is my [first / second] reminder
 
Tone: polite and respectful, but clear that payment is now expected. I want
to keep this customer, so no threats - just a firm, easy request to settle,
with a way for them to reply if there is a problem. End by asking for a
payment date.

Fill the brackets, send the prompt, and you have a clean draft in seconds.

Why it comes out well#

Three things in that prompt do the work. The facts are yours, so nothing is invented. The tone is stated exactly - firm but not hostile - which is the hard part to get right when you are the one who is owed money. And the goal is explicit: get a payment date, keep the relationship.

The real win#

The point is not that the AI writes a better letter than you could. It is that it writes it now, instead of next week - and a reminder that goes out today gets paid sooner than one you keep meaning to write. Removing the friction is the whole value.
